Why it is important to answer genres you have studied in detail during the year?

Genres help readers to anticipate what they are likely to find in a document and how they can use the information in it. When you understand what your readers expect, you can make strategic choices about what information you will include and how you will present it (Figure 1.1).

Why is it important for teachers to understand the characteristics of the different genres of children’s literature?

Bridging Literacies. Explicitly teaching students to recognize specific genres helps to bridge the gap between literacies students see at home and at school. At home, students are not necessarily exposed to the same types of texts as they are at school.

What is the benefits of writing through genres?

The genre group did better than the non-genre group, and the data showed that knowledge of the typical structure of the content made it easier for learners to arrange their ideas in terms of both achieving their communicative goals and producing more well-organized writing.

Why is it important for students to understand a genre’s purpose and intended audience?

It is important for students to understand the purpose of different genres, so that they can select the genre best suited to their writing task. In teaching a particular genre, teachers should emphasize the purpose of that genre and how its features are related to the purpose of the writing task.
